Transaction 5317689e7a8d2b0d83cc4b948363e76b5694570595e4215748a337aa29891c39
1 Input
1 Output
-
5317689e7a8d2b0d83cc4b948363e76b5694570595e4215748a337aa29891c39:0
- value
- 621620
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 eccd96cc109789dfad4e9cff90d4f4bcbb210233 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Nb6krHMF1FPuLCr4W4JSH3SQR9KLBW7tw